  • VW Osbourne Park just S&^t me off

    I had my doubts about the oil and oil filter being changed last service ( 2 year 30000km ) so decided to put a rub mark on the filter this time and surprise, surprise the filter hasn't been changed ( oil is clean though ).

    Gave me some crap about its not required at an intermediate service and its a fixed price service anyway but the point is they are happy to put stuff on the invoice they have clearly not done and keep a straight face about it.

    I couldn't be bothered arguing and made it quite clear they will never again see the GTI.

    Anyway on to the point of the thread. Since it was the last service it will be getting under warranty who to take it to next in Perth.

    Pretty sure it was Golfwagen and Quattro Motors where the ones to see when I was last snooping around here. I'm inner northern suburbs but don't mind a bit of a drive as long as what should be done, what I ask to get done and what I get charged to be done all add up to the same thing. Don't even give a dam about putting up with a temperamental bastard of a mechanic. Usually find they do the best job!!!
